What is the Outlook for Progressive Web Apps?

Progressive Web Apps, or PWAs, represent a blend of web and mobile applications, delivering an experience that combines the best of both worlds. They are designed to work on any platform with a standards-compliant browser. From my experience, the outlook for PWAs is promising, thanks to their ability to provide fast, reliable, and engaging user experiences. Companies like Pinterest and Twitter have successfully embraced PWAs, witnessing significant improvements in user engagement and performance.

  • Accessible on any device with a browser, PWAs eliminate the need for separate app stores.
  • They can work offline or in low-network conditions, offering a seamless experience.
  • Updates are instant and do not require user intervention, keeping the app current with the latest features.
  • PWAs are cost-effective compared to native apps, reducing development and maintenance costs.
  • They can be easily shared via URLs, enhancing discoverability and user reach.

Step-by-Step Guide to Implementing Progressive Web Apps

How to Create a PWA: Complete Guide

Step 1

Understand the PWA Basics

Before diving into development, familiarize yourself with the core principles of PWAs, including service workers, web app manifests, and responsive design.

  • Review Google's PWA documentation for foundational knowledge.
  • Experiment with existing PWAs to see their features in action.
Step 2

Set Up Your Development Environment

Choose a framework or library that supports PWA development, such as React or Angular. Install necessary tools, including Node.js and npm.

  • Use a local server for testing to simulate a real-world environment.
  • Consider using tools like Lighthouse to evaluate your PWA's performance.
Step 3

Create a Web App Manifest

This file provides metadata for your app, including its name, icons, and theme colors. It's crucial for enabling the 'add to home screen' prompt.

  • Ensure your manifest file is correctly linked in your HTML.
  • Test different icon sizes to ensure they display well on various devices.
Step 4

Implement Service Workers

Service workers are scripts that run in the background, enabling offline capabilities and caching. Register your service worker and implement caching strategies.

  • Start with a simple service worker to cache essential assets.
  • Gradually expand your service worker's functionality as you become more comfortable.
Step 5

Test and Optimize

Use tools like Google Lighthouse to audit your PWA's performance, accessibility, and SEO. Make necessary adjustments based on feedback.

  • Conduct user testing to gather real-world insights.
  • Iterate on your design and functionality based on user feedback.

Pros and Cons of Progressive Web Apps

✅ Pros

  • Cross-Platform Compatibility

    PWAs work seamlessly across different devices and operating systems. This means you can reach a wider audience without developing separate applications for iOS and Android. Companies like Uber have seen increased user engagement thanks to their PWA's accessibility.

  • Improved Loading Times

    Thanks to caching and other performance optimizations, PWAs often load faster than traditional websites. For example, the PWA for Alibaba improved load times by over 70%, leading to increased sales.

  • Cost-Effectiveness

    Developing a PWA can be more affordable than building native apps. You only need to maintain one codebase, which reduces development and maintenance costs for businesses.

❌ Cons

  • Limited Functionality on iOS

    While PWAs work well on most platforms, iOS has some limitations, such as not fully supporting service workers. This can hinder performance and capabilities for iPhone users, potentially affecting user experience negatively.

  • Discoverability Issues

    PWAs are not listed in app stores, which can make them harder to discover compared to native apps. You need to invest in marketing strategies to ensure users know about your PWA.

  • Requires Internet Connectivity

    Although PWAs can work offline, some features still require internet access. Users may encounter limitations if their connectivity is poor, which can lead to frustration.

Common Mistakes to Avoid When Building PWAs

When developing a PWA, it’s easy to make mistakes that can undermine its effectiveness. One common pitfall is neglecting the web app manifest. This file is crucial for providing information about your app, and failing to configure it correctly can prevent users from adding your app to their home screens.

Another mistake is not testing your PWA on various devices and browsers. Given the diversity of devices in use today, your app must perform well across different environments. It’s essential to test thoroughly to catch any issues before launch.

  • Overlooking SEO best practices can limit your app’s visibility. Ensure that your PWA is optimized for search engines.
  • Failing to implement service workers properly can lead to poor offline performance. Take time to learn how to use service workers effectively.
  • Ignoring user feedback can hinder your app’s growth. Regularly gather input from users and make adjustments based on their suggestions.

Advanced Tips for Maximizing Your PWA’s Performance

For those looking to push their PWAs to the next level, consider implementing advanced techniques. First, optimize your service workers by leveraging caching strategies effectively. For instance, use the Cache First strategy for assets that rarely change, while employing the Network First approach for dynamic content that updates frequently. This can greatly enhance loading speeds and overall user experience.

Another advanced tip is to utilize lazy loading for images and other media. This technique ensures that resources are only loaded when they enter the viewport, reducing initial load times and improving performance metrics.

  • Set up performance monitoring tools to continuously track your PWA’s performance and identify areas for improvement.
  • Explore offline-first design principles, ensuring that your app remains functional even without connectivity.
  • Experiment with Progressive Enhancement techniques to ensure that your PWA remains functional across different browsers and devices.
